Audi introduced transponder keys to their cars in the early 1990s. These keys are equipped with a microchip inside the head of the key which sends unique signals when it is inserted into your car's ignition. The computer in the vehicle reads the signal and, if it matches the information the engine will begin.

The advantage of this technology is that the transponder's code is constantly changing, making it more difficult to duplicate or hack. This technology has significantly decreased the incidence of car thefts, particularly for luxury cars that are expensive.

Key Fobs

Most modern cars come with fobs with keys that allow you to open and start the car. Fobs are equipped with proximity sensors that communicate with the car to activate its systems. The sensor on the fob sends a signal that identifies you as the owner of the vehicle. The immobiliser chip is activated so you can start the car. If you lose your Audi key, it is not possible to gain access or start the car without a replacement.

These keys are more complex than traditional keys made of metal. They must be programmed to work with your vehicle and this can only be accomplished by a dealer or locksmith who has the appropriate equipment to program these latest kinds of cars.

The price of a fob is usually higher than that of an ordinary metal key. This is due to the fact that they are generally more complicated and require more technology. It can be costly to replace the fob if it gets damaged or lost.

Smart Keys

Audi has taken car keys to a new level with their new smart key technology. These wireless keys, in contrast to traditional metal keys, come with a proximity sensors that allow drivers to lock and unlock their cars without having to touch a button. This can be a huge benefit for people with mobility issues, young children, or anyone else who might have difficulty reaching traditional vehicle keys.

These Audi smart keys aren't only convenient, but they also have safety features to protect them from thieves who are tech-savvy. While standard keys broadcast the same frequency signal every time a driver opens or locks their doors smart keys broadcast encrypted signals that are specific to each door and trunk. This helps to prevent theft by making it difficult for thieves to guess the code and take over a vehicle, reports Open Road Auto Group.

Smart keys can also start a vehicle even when they're not in the ignition. This feature is useful when you're loading your kids, groceries, or other heavy items into your vehicle, or when you are wearing gloves and do not want to remove your gloves to access your keys.
